Rescue story: the “Helen Summerfield-Brown” group came to the rescue of a street dog unable to move, burdened by a giant tumor hanging helplessly on its belly, discovered on the side of the road.

In a touching display of compassion and dedication, the non-profit group “Helen Summerfield-Brown” recently came to the rescue of a helpless dog discovered on the side of the road. Unable to move and burdened by a giant tumor hanging from its abdomen, this poor creature’s fate seemed bleak. However, leaving him there was unacceptable to volunteers committed to saving stray and abandoned animals.

Determined to make a difference, the group quickly intervened, picked up the sick dog and took him to the hospital for immediate medical attention. The dog, later named Midnight, was in critical condition, refusing to eat, suggesting the tumor was affecting its health.

Upon arriving at the hospital, Midnight underwent a series of tests, including blood tests, X-rays and ultrasounds. Veterinarians discovered a myriad of problems, including hookworms, anemia and malnutrition. To make matters worse, Midnight’s blood platelet count was dangerously low, making surgical removal of the tumor impossible at the time.

Time is of the essence as the tumor continues to grow, posing a serious threat to Midnight’s life. The dedicated team performed all the necessary blood tests to determine the optimal timing for surgery, not wanting to give up on this special dog.

Despite the challenges, Midnight’s surgery was ultimately successful and the large tumor, identified as a testicular tumor, was removed. Weighing approximately 4.85 pounds, the tumor was a significant burden on Midnight’s fragile body.

The veterinarian expressed relief, saying: “It was such a burden on his fragile little body, and I’m so happy for him that he’s no longer there. Midnight, who was able to Walking a few steps after surgery, made us very happy.” proud.”

The rescuers’ love and dedication showed through their commitment to Midnight’s well-being. “We love this boy and will do everything in our power to help him,” they affirmed.

Midnight’s health is gradually improving and he is expected to be ready for adoption in just a few days. The journey from a tragic roadside discovery to a successful surgery and road to recovery has been nothing short of remarkable.
